Sūrah 38
Ṣād
Sad · 88 verses
Bismillāhir-Raḥmānir-Raḥeem
- 1Sad. By the Qur'an containing reminderصٓۚ وَٱلۡقُرۡءَانِ ذِي ٱلذِّكۡرِ
- 2But those who disbelieve are in pride and dissensionبَلِ ٱلَّذِينَ كَفَرُواْ فِي عِزَّةٖ وَشِقَاقٖ
- 3How many a generation have We destroyed before them, and they [then] called out; but it was not a time for escapeكَمۡ أَهۡلَكۡنَا مِن قَبۡلِهِم مِّن قَرۡنٖ فَنَادَواْ وَّلَاتَ حِينَ مَنَاصٖ
- 4And they wonder that there has come to them a warner from among themselves. And the disbelievers say, "This is a magician and a liarوَعَجِبُوٓاْ أَن جَآءَهُم مُّنذِرٞ مِّنۡهُمۡۖ وَقَالَ ٱلۡكَٰفِرُونَ هَٰذَا سَٰحِرٞ كَذَّابٌ
- 5Has he made the gods [only] one God? Indeed, this is a curious thingأَجَعَلَ ٱلۡأٓلِهَةَ إِلَٰهٗا وَٰحِدًاۖ إِنَّ هَٰذَا لَشَيۡءٌ عُجَابٞ
- 6And the eminent among them went forth, [saying], "Continue, and be patient over [the defense of] your gods. Indeed, this is a thing intendedوَٱنطَلَقَ ٱلۡمَلَأُ مِنۡهُمۡ أَنِ ٱمۡشُواْ وَٱصۡبِرُواْ عَلَىٰٓ ءَالِهَتِكُمۡۖ إِنَّ هَٰذَا لَشَيۡءٞ يُرَادُ
- 7We have not heard of this in the latest religion. This is not but a fabricationمَا سَمِعۡنَا بِهَٰذَا فِي ٱلۡمِلَّةِ ٱلۡأٓخِرَةِ إِنۡ هَٰذَآ إِلَّا ٱخۡتِلَٰقٌ
- 8Has the message been revealed to him out of [all of] us?" Rather, they are in doubt about My message. Rather, they have not yet tasted My punishmentأَءُنزِلَ عَلَيۡهِ ٱلذِّكۡرُ مِنۢ بَيۡنِنَاۚ بَلۡ هُمۡ فِي شَكّٖ مِّن ذِكۡرِيۚ بَل لَّمَّا يَذُوقُواْ عَذَابِ
- 9Or do they have the depositories of the mercy of your Lord, the Exalted in Might, the Bestowerأَمۡ عِندَهُمۡ خَزَآئِنُ رَحۡمَةِ رَبِّكَ ٱلۡعَزِيزِ ٱلۡوَهَّابِ
- 10Or is theirs the dominion of the heavens and the earth and what is between them? Then let them ascend through [any] ways of accessأَمۡ لَهُم مُّلۡكُ ٱلسَّمَٰوَٰتِ وَٱلۡأَرۡضِ وَمَا بَيۡنَهُمَاۖ فَلۡيَرۡتَقُواْ فِي ٱلۡأَسۡبَٰبِ
- 11[They are but] soldiers [who will be] defeated there among the companies [of disbelievers]جُندٞ مَّا هُنَالِكَ مَهۡزُومٞ مِّنَ ٱلۡأَحۡزَابِ
- 12The people of Noah denied before them, and [the tribe of] 'Aad and Pharaoh, the owner of stakesكَذَّبَتۡ قَبۡلَهُمۡ قَوۡمُ نُوحٖ وَعَادٞ وَفِرۡعَوۡنُ ذُو ٱلۡأَوۡتَادِ
- 13And [the tribe of] Thamud and the people of Lot and the companions of the thicket. Those are the companiesوَثَمُودُ وَقَوۡمُ لُوطٖ وَأَصۡحَٰبُ لۡـَٔيۡكَةِۚ أُوْلَـٰٓئِكَ ٱلۡأَحۡزَابُ
- 14Each of them denied the messengers, so My penalty was justifiedإِن كُلٌّ إِلَّا كَذَّبَ ٱلرُّسُلَ فَحَقَّ عِقَابِ
- 15And these [disbelievers] await not but one blast [of the Horn]; for it there will be no delayوَمَا يَنظُرُ هَـٰٓؤُلَآءِ إِلَّا صَيۡحَةٗ وَٰحِدَةٗ مَّا لَهَا مِن فَوَاقٖ
- 16And they say, "Our Lord, hasten for us our share [of the punishment] before the Day of Accountوَقَالُواْ رَبَّنَا عَجِّل لَّنَا قِطَّنَا قَبۡلَ يَوۡمِ ٱلۡحِسَابِ
- 17Be patient over what they say and remember Our servant, David, the possessor of strength; indeed, he was one who repeatedly turned back [to Allāh]ٱصۡبِرۡ عَلَىٰ مَا يَقُولُونَ وَٱذۡكُرۡ عَبۡدَنَا دَاوُۥدَ ذَا ٱلۡأَيۡدِۖ إِنَّهُۥٓ أَوَّابٌ
- 18Indeed, We subjected the mountains [to praise] with him, exalting [Allāh] in the [late] afternoon and [after] sunriseإِنَّا سَخَّرۡنَا ٱلۡجِبَالَ مَعَهُۥ يُسَبِّحۡنَ بِٱلۡعَشِيِّ وَٱلۡإِشۡرَاقِ
- 19And the birds were assembled, all with him repeating [praises]وَٱلطَّيۡرَ مَحۡشُورَةٗۖ كُلّٞ لَّهُۥٓ أَوَّابٞ
- 20And We strengthened his kingdom and gave him wisdom and discernment in speechوَشَدَدۡنَا مُلۡكَهُۥ وَءَاتَيۡنَٰهُ ٱلۡحِكۡمَةَ وَفَصۡلَ ٱلۡخِطَابِ
- 21And has there come to you the news of the adversaries, when they climbed over the wall of [his] prayer chamber۞وَهَلۡ أَتَىٰكَ نَبَؤُاْ ٱلۡخَصۡمِ إِذۡ تَسَوَّرُواْ ٱلۡمِحۡرَابَ
- 22When they entered upon David and he was alarmed by them? They said, "Fear not. [We are] two adversaries, one of whom has wronged the other, so judge between us with truth and do not exceed [it] and guide us to the sound pathإِذۡ دَخَلُواْ عَلَىٰ دَاوُۥدَ فَفَزِعَ مِنۡهُمۡۖ قَالُواْ لَا تَخَفۡۖ خَصۡمَانِ بَغَىٰ بَعۡضُنَا عَلَىٰ بَعۡضٖ فَٱحۡكُم بَيۡنَنَا بِٱلۡحَقِّ وَلَا تُشۡطِطۡ وَٱهۡدِنَآ إِلَىٰ سَوَآءِ ٱلصِّرَٰطِ
- 23Indeed this, my brother, has ninety-nine ewes, and I have one ewe; so he said, 'Entrust her to me,' and he overpowered me in speechإِنَّ هَٰذَآ أَخِي لَهُۥ تِسۡعٞ وَتِسۡعُونَ نَعۡجَةٗ وَلِيَ نَعۡجَةٞ وَٰحِدَةٞ فَقَالَ أَكۡفِلۡنِيهَا وَعَزَّنِي فِي ٱلۡخِطَابِ
- 24[David] said, "He has certainly wronged you in demanding your ewe [in addition] to his ewes. And indeed, many associates oppress one another, except for those who believe and do righteous deeds - and few are they." And David became certain that We had tried him, and he asked forgiveness of his Lord and fell down bowing [in prostration] and turned in repentance [to Allāh]قَالَ لَقَدۡ ظَلَمَكَ بِسُؤَالِ نَعۡجَتِكَ إِلَىٰ نِعَاجِهِۦۖ وَإِنَّ كَثِيرٗا مِّنَ ٱلۡخُلَطَآءِ لَيَبۡغِي بَعۡضُهُمۡ عَلَىٰ بَعۡضٍ إِلَّا ٱلَّذِينَ ءَامَنُواْ وَعَمِلُواْ ٱلصَّـٰلِحَٰتِ وَقَلِيلٞ مَّا هُمۡۗ وَظَنَّ دَاوُۥدُ أَنَّمَا فَتَنَّـٰهُ فَٱسۡتَغۡفَرَ رَبَّهُۥ وَخَرَّۤ رَاكِعٗاۤ وَأَنَابَ۩
- 25So We forgave him that; and indeed, for him is nearness to Us and a good place of returnفَغَفَرۡنَا لَهُۥ ذَٰلِكَۖ وَإِنَّ لَهُۥ عِندَنَا لَزُلۡفَىٰ وَحُسۡنَ مَـَٔابٖ
- 26[We said], "O David, indeed We have made you a successor upon the earth, so judge between the people in truth and do not follow [your own] desire, as it will lead you astray from the way of Allāh." Indeed, those who go astray from the way of Allāh will have a severe punishment for having forgotten the Day of Accountيَٰدَاوُۥدُ إِنَّا جَعَلۡنَٰكَ خَلِيفَةٗ فِي ٱلۡأَرۡضِ فَٱحۡكُم بَيۡنَ ٱلنَّاسِ بِٱلۡحَقِّ وَلَا تَتَّبِعِ ٱلۡهَوَىٰ فَيُضِلَّكَ عَن سَبِيلِ ٱللَّهِۚ إِنَّ ٱلَّذِينَ يَضِلُّونَ عَن سَبِيلِ ٱللَّهِ لَهُمۡ عَذَابٞ شَدِيدُۢ بِمَا نَسُواْ يَوۡمَ ٱلۡحِسَابِ
- 27And We did not create the heaven and the earth and that between them aimlessly. That is the assumption of those who disbelieve, so woe to those who disbelieve from the Fireوَمَا خَلَقۡنَا ٱلسَّمَآءَ وَٱلۡأَرۡضَ وَمَا بَيۡنَهُمَا بَٰطِلٗاۚ ذَٰلِكَ ظَنُّ ٱلَّذِينَ كَفَرُواْۚ فَوَيۡلٞ لِّلَّذِينَ كَفَرُواْ مِنَ ٱلنَّارِ
- 28Or should we treat those who believe and do righteous deeds like corrupters in the land? Or should We treat those who fear Allāh like the wickedأَمۡ نَجۡعَلُ ٱلَّذِينَ ءَامَنُواْ وَعَمِلُواْ ٱلصَّـٰلِحَٰتِ كَٱلۡمُفۡسِدِينَ فِي ٱلۡأَرۡضِ أَمۡ نَجۡعَلُ ٱلۡمُتَّقِينَ كَٱلۡفُجَّارِ
- 29[This is] a blessed Book which We have revealed to you, [O Muḥammad], that they might reflect upon its verses and that those of understanding would be remindedكِتَٰبٌ أَنزَلۡنَٰهُ إِلَيۡكَ مُبَٰرَكٞ لِّيَدَّبَّرُوٓاْ ءَايَٰتِهِۦ وَلِيَتَذَكَّرَ أُوْلُواْ ٱلۡأَلۡبَٰبِ
- 30And to David We gave Solomon. An excellent servant, indeed he was one repeatedly turning back [to Allāh]وَوَهَبۡنَا لِدَاوُۥدَ سُلَيۡمَٰنَۚ نِعۡمَ ٱلۡعَبۡدُ إِنَّهُۥٓ أَوَّابٌ
- 31[Mention] when there were exhibited before him in the afternoon the poised [standing] racehorsesإِذۡ عُرِضَ عَلَيۡهِ بِٱلۡعَشِيِّ ٱلصَّـٰفِنَٰتُ ٱلۡجِيَادُ
- 32And he said, "Indeed, I gave preference to the love of good [things] over the remembrance of my Lord until the sun disappeared into the curtain [of darkness]فَقَالَ إِنِّيٓ أَحۡبَبۡتُ حُبَّ ٱلۡخَيۡرِ عَن ذِكۡرِ رَبِّي حَتَّىٰ تَوَارَتۡ بِٱلۡحِجَابِ
- 33[He said], "Return them to me," and set about striking [their] legs and necksرُدُّوهَا عَلَيَّۖ فَطَفِقَ مَسۡحَۢا بِٱلسُّوقِ وَٱلۡأَعۡنَاقِ
- 34And We certainly tried Solomon and placed on his throne a body; then he returnedوَلَقَدۡ فَتَنَّا سُلَيۡمَٰنَ وَأَلۡقَيۡنَا عَلَىٰ كُرۡسِيِّهِۦ جَسَدٗا ثُمَّ أَنَابَ
- 35He said, "My Lord, forgive me and grant me a kingdom such as will not belong to anyone after me. Indeed, You are the Bestowerقَالَ رَبِّ ٱغۡفِرۡ لِي وَهَبۡ لِي مُلۡكٗا لَّا يَنۢبَغِي لِأَحَدٖ مِّنۢ بَعۡدِيٓۖ إِنَّكَ أَنتَ ٱلۡوَهَّابُ
- 36So We subjected to him the wind blowing by his command, gently, wherever he directedفَسَخَّرۡنَا لَهُ ٱلرِّيحَ تَجۡرِي بِأَمۡرِهِۦ رُخَآءً حَيۡثُ أَصَابَ
- 37And [also] the devils [of jinn] - every builder and diverوَٱلشَّيَٰطِينَ كُلَّ بَنَّآءٖ وَغَوَّاصٖ
- 38And others bound together in shacklesوَءَاخَرِينَ مُقَرَّنِينَ فِي ٱلۡأَصۡفَادِ
- 39[We said], "This is Our gift, so grant or withhold without accountهَٰذَا عَطَآؤُنَا فَٱمۡنُنۡ أَوۡ أَمۡسِكۡ بِغَيۡرِ حِسَابٖ
- 40And indeed, for him is nearness to Us and a good place of returnوَإِنَّ لَهُۥ عِندَنَا لَزُلۡفَىٰ وَحُسۡنَ مَـَٔابٖ
- 41And remember Our servant Job, when he called to his Lord, "Indeed, Satan has touched me with hardship and tormentوَٱذۡكُرۡ عَبۡدَنَآ أَيُّوبَ إِذۡ نَادَىٰ رَبَّهُۥٓ أَنِّي مَسَّنِيَ ٱلشَّيۡطَٰنُ بِنُصۡبٖ وَعَذَابٍ
- 42[So he was told], "Strike [the ground] with your foot; this is a [spring for] a cool bath and drinkٱرۡكُضۡ بِرِجۡلِكَۖ هَٰذَا مُغۡتَسَلُۢ بَارِدٞ وَشَرَابٞ
- 43And We granted him his family and a like [number] with them as mercy from Us and a reminder for those of understandingوَوَهَبۡنَا لَهُۥٓ أَهۡلَهُۥ وَمِثۡلَهُم مَّعَهُمۡ رَحۡمَةٗ مِّنَّا وَذِكۡرَىٰ لِأُوْلِي ٱلۡأَلۡبَٰبِ
- 44[We said], "And take in your hand a bunch [of grass] and strike with it and do not break your oath." Indeed, We found him patient, an excellent servant. Indeed, he was one repeatedly turning back [to Allāh]وَخُذۡ بِيَدِكَ ضِغۡثٗا فَٱضۡرِب بِّهِۦ وَلَا تَحۡنَثۡۗ إِنَّا وَجَدۡنَٰهُ صَابِرٗاۚ نِّعۡمَ ٱلۡعَبۡدُ إِنَّهُۥٓ أَوَّابٞ
- 45And remember Our servants, Abraham, Isaac and Jacob - those of strength and [religious] visionوَٱذۡكُرۡ عِبَٰدَنَآ إِبۡرَٰهِيمَ وَإِسۡحَٰقَ وَيَعۡقُوبَ أُوْلِي ٱلۡأَيۡدِي وَٱلۡأَبۡصَٰرِ
- 46Indeed, We chose them for an exclusive quality: remembrance of the home [of the Hereafter]إِنَّآ أَخۡلَصۡنَٰهُم بِخَالِصَةٖ ذِكۡرَى ٱلدَّارِ
- 47And indeed they are, to Us, among the chosen and outstandingوَإِنَّهُمۡ عِندَنَا لَمِنَ ٱلۡمُصۡطَفَيۡنَ ٱلۡأَخۡيَارِ
- 48And remember Ishmael, Elisha and Dhul-Kifl, and all are among the outstandingوَٱذۡكُرۡ إِسۡمَٰعِيلَ وَٱلۡيَسَعَ وَذَا ٱلۡكِفۡلِۖ وَكُلّٞ مِّنَ ٱلۡأَخۡيَارِ
- 49This is a reminder. And indeed, for the righteous is a good place of returnهَٰذَا ذِكۡرٞۚ وَإِنَّ لِلۡمُتَّقِينَ لَحُسۡنَ مَـَٔابٖ
- 50Gardens of perpetual residence, whose doors will be opened to themجَنَّـٰتِ عَدۡنٖ مُّفَتَّحَةٗ لَّهُمُ ٱلۡأَبۡوَٰبُ
- 51Reclining within them, they will call therein for abundant fruit and drinkمُتَّكِـِٔينَ فِيهَا يَدۡعُونَ فِيهَا بِفَٰكِهَةٖ كَثِيرَةٖ وَشَرَابٖ
- 52And with them will be women limiting [their] glances and of equal age۞وَعِندَهُمۡ قَٰصِرَٰتُ ٱلطَّرۡفِ أَتۡرَابٌ
- 53This is what you, [the righteous], are promised for the Day of Accountهَٰذَا مَا تُوعَدُونَ لِيَوۡمِ ٱلۡحِسَابِ
- 54Indeed, this is Our provision; for it there is no depletionإِنَّ هَٰذَا لَرِزۡقُنَا مَا لَهُۥ مِن نَّفَادٍ
- 55This [is so]. But indeed, for the transgressors is an evil place of returnهَٰذَاۚ وَإِنَّ لِلطَّـٰغِينَ لَشَرَّ مَـَٔابٖ
- 56Hell, which they will [enter to] burn, and wretched is the resting placeجَهَنَّمَ يَصۡلَوۡنَهَا فَبِئۡسَ ٱلۡمِهَادُ
- 57This - so let them taste it - is scalding water and [foul] purulenceهَٰذَا فَلۡيَذُوقُوهُ حَمِيمٞ وَغَسَّاقٞ
- 58And other [punishments] of its type [in various] kindsوَءَاخَرُ مِن شَكۡلِهِۦٓ أَزۡوَٰجٌ
- 59[Its inhabitants will say], "This is a company bursting in with you. No welcome for them. Indeed, they will burn in the Fireهَٰذَا فَوۡجٞ مُّقۡتَحِمٞ مَّعَكُمۡ لَا مَرۡحَبَۢا بِهِمۡۚ إِنَّهُمۡ صَالُواْ ٱلنَّارِ
- 60They will say, "Nor you! No welcome for you. You, [our leaders], brought this upon us, and wretched is the settlementقَالُواْ بَلۡ أَنتُمۡ لَا مَرۡحَبَۢا بِكُمۡۖ أَنتُمۡ قَدَّمۡتُمُوهُ لَنَاۖ فَبِئۡسَ ٱلۡقَرَارُ
- 61They will say, "Our Lord, whoever brought this upon us - increase for him double punishment in the Fireقَالُواْ رَبَّنَا مَن قَدَّمَ لَنَا هَٰذَا فَزِدۡهُ عَذَابٗا ضِعۡفٗا فِي ٱلنَّارِ
- 62And they will say, "Why do we not see men whom we used to count among the worstوَقَالُواْ مَا لَنَا لَا نَرَىٰ رِجَالٗا كُنَّا نَعُدُّهُم مِّنَ ٱلۡأَشۡرَارِ
- 63Is it [because] we took them in ridicule, or has [our] vision turned away from themأَتَّخَذۡنَٰهُمۡ سِخۡرِيًّا أَمۡ زَاغَتۡ عَنۡهُمُ ٱلۡأَبۡصَٰرُ
- 64Indeed, that is truth - the quarreling of the people of the Fireإِنَّ ذَٰلِكَ لَحَقّٞ تَخَاصُمُ أَهۡلِ ٱلنَّارِ
- 65Say, [O Muḥammad], "I am only a warner, and there is not any deity except Allāh, the One, the Prevailingقُلۡ إِنَّمَآ أَنَا۠ مُنذِرٞۖ وَمَا مِنۡ إِلَٰهٍ إِلَّا ٱللَّهُ ٱلۡوَٰحِدُ ٱلۡقَهَّارُ
- 66Lord of the heavens and the earth and whatever is between them, the Exalted in Might, the Perpetual Forgiverرَبُّ ٱلسَّمَٰوَٰتِ وَٱلۡأَرۡضِ وَمَا بَيۡنَهُمَا ٱلۡعَزِيزُ ٱلۡغَفَّـٰرُ
- 67Say, "It is great newsقُلۡ هُوَ نَبَؤٌاْ عَظِيمٌ
- 68From which you turn awayأَنتُمۡ عَنۡهُ مُعۡرِضُونَ
- 69I had no knowledge of the exalted assembly [of angels] when they were disputing [the creation of Adam]مَا كَانَ لِيَ مِنۡ عِلۡمِۭ بِٱلۡمَلَإِ ٱلۡأَعۡلَىٰٓ إِذۡ يَخۡتَصِمُونَ
- 70It has not been revealed to me except that I am a clear warnerإِن يُوحَىٰٓ إِلَيَّ إِلَّآ أَنَّمَآ أَنَا۠ نَذِيرٞ مُّبِينٌ
- 71[So mention] when your Lord said to the angels, "Indeed, I am going to create a human being from clayإِذۡ قَالَ رَبُّكَ لِلۡمَلَـٰٓئِكَةِ إِنِّي خَٰلِقُۢ بَشَرٗا مِّن طِينٖ
- 72So when I have proportioned him and breathed into him of My [created] soul, then fall down to him in prostrationفَإِذَا سَوَّيۡتُهُۥ وَنَفَخۡتُ فِيهِ مِن رُّوحِي فَقَعُواْ لَهُۥ سَٰجِدِينَ
- 73So the angels prostrated - all of them entirelyفَسَجَدَ ٱلۡمَلَـٰٓئِكَةُ كُلُّهُمۡ أَجۡمَعُونَ
- 74Except Iblees; he was arrogant and became among the disbelieversإِلَّآ إِبۡلِيسَ ٱسۡتَكۡبَرَ وَكَانَ مِنَ ٱلۡكَٰفِرِينَ
- 75[Allāh] said, "O Iblees, what prevented you from prostrating to that which I created with My hands? Were you arrogant [then], or were you [already] among the haughtyقَالَ يَـٰٓإِبۡلِيسُ مَا مَنَعَكَ أَن تَسۡجُدَ لِمَا خَلَقۡتُ بِيَدَيَّۖ أَسۡتَكۡبَرۡتَ أَمۡ كُنتَ مِنَ ٱلۡعَالِينَ
- 76He said, "I am better than him. You created me from fire and created him from clayقَالَ أَنَا۠ خَيۡرٞ مِّنۡهُ خَلَقۡتَنِي مِن نَّارٖ وَخَلَقۡتَهُۥ مِن طِينٖ
- 77[Allāh] said, "Then get out of Paradise, for indeed, you are expelledقَالَ فَٱخۡرُجۡ مِنۡهَا فَإِنَّكَ رَجِيمٞ
- 78And indeed, upon you is My curse until the Day of Recompenseوَإِنَّ عَلَيۡكَ لَعۡنَتِيٓ إِلَىٰ يَوۡمِ ٱلدِّينِ
- 79He said, "My Lord, then reprieve me until the Day they are resurrectedقَالَ رَبِّ فَأَنظِرۡنِيٓ إِلَىٰ يَوۡمِ يُبۡعَثُونَ
- 80[Allāh] said, "So indeed, you are of those reprievedقَالَ فَإِنَّكَ مِنَ ٱلۡمُنظَرِينَ
- 81Until the Day of the time well-knownإِلَىٰ يَوۡمِ ٱلۡوَقۡتِ ٱلۡمَعۡلُومِ
- 82[Iblees] said, "By your might, I will surely mislead them allقَالَ فَبِعِزَّتِكَ لَأُغۡوِيَنَّهُمۡ أَجۡمَعِينَ
- 83Except, among them, Your chosen servantsإِلَّا عِبَادَكَ مِنۡهُمُ ٱلۡمُخۡلَصِينَ
- 84[Allāh] said, "The truth [is My oath], and the truth I sayقَالَ فَٱلۡحَقُّ وَٱلۡحَقَّ أَقُولُ
- 85[That] I will surely fill Hell with you and those of them that follow you all togetherلَأَمۡلَأَنَّ جَهَنَّمَ مِنكَ وَمِمَّن تَبِعَكَ مِنۡهُمۡ أَجۡمَعِينَ
- 86Say, [O Muḥammad], "I do not ask you for the Qur'an any payment, and I am not of the pretentiousقُلۡ مَآ أَسۡـَٔلُكُمۡ عَلَيۡهِ مِنۡ أَجۡرٖ وَمَآ أَنَا۠ مِنَ ٱلۡمُتَكَلِّفِينَ
- 87It is but a reminder to the worldsإِنۡ هُوَ إِلَّا ذِكۡرٞ لِّلۡعَٰلَمِينَ
- 88And you will surely know [the truth of] its information after a timeوَلَتَعۡلَمُنَّ نَبَأَهُۥ بَعۡدَ حِينِۭ
